Floods In Texas Leave At Least 80 Dead And Widespread Damage
Widespread damage is visible in and around Kerrville, Texas, on July 6, 2025, following a deadly flash flood that causes the Guadalupe River to rise 26 feet in less than an hour early Friday morning. 80 people are confirmed dead, and 40 more remain missing.
